The story
On Bluewaters Island, with the Ain Dubai wheel as a backdrop, The Spaniel brings a distinctly British brasserie and bar to Dubai Marina. The restaurant describes itself as a “timeless destination” that channels the modern charm of London and other worldly capitals, offering a gourmet experience from breakfast through to late-night drinks, seven days a week.
The dining room is styled with the warmth of a private British club, spread over two floors and six distinct areas named after famous landmarks: Eton, Picadilly, Oxford, and Soho. For those who prefer the open air, the outdoor terrace delivers postcard views of Bluewaters and the iconic wheel. The bar, meanwhile, feels like a festive spot carved out of a Berkeley Square townhouse, complete with a cozy fireplace and a snug for cocktails and liquors.
The kitchen focuses on British Contemporary cuisine, crafting a range of options that includes the famous Wellington Beef on Wednesdays, a steak frites offering on Fridays, and an all-day Sunday Roast. The weekend brunch is described as a “friends and family” party, while the weekdays bring a happy hour and long Sundowner events. The restaurant’s own words sum up the philosophy with a quote from Winston Churchill: “My taste is simple. I am easily satisfied with the best.”
The Spaniel’s quality has been recognized with a Michelin Recommended award, a nod that places it among the noteworthy dining destinations in Dubai. Whether you are stopping in for a late, lazy breakfast, a business lunch on the first floor, or a vibrant evening out, the atmosphere is designed to be memorable without pretension. Walk-ins are welcome for drinks and lighter bites, making it a flexible spot for both planned dinners and spontaneous visits.
